What Makes The Legend of Zelda So Special?
At its core, The Legend of Zelda combines action, exploration, and puzzle-solving in a seamless experience. Players take on the role of Link, a courageous hero tasked with rescuing Princess Zelda and saving the kingdom from evil forces, often the infamous villain Ganon. The games are known for their open-world design, allowing players to explore vast landscapes, uncover hidden secrets, and solve intricate dungeons.
Evolution of the Series
Over the years, the franchise has evolved dramatically, adapting to new gaming technology while retaining the elements that make it unique. From the 8-bit simplicity of the original NES game to the breathtaking open world of The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ild, each title brings fresh innovations. Breath of the Wild, released in 2017, redefined the series with its vast open world, physics-based puzzles, and non-linear gameplay, earning critical acclaim and numerous awards.
